How Bob Macdonald's Games Finished Compares to Similar Players
Bob Macdonald totaled 55 career Games Finished, well below the relief pitcher average of 70.1 — production that significantly underperformed against league baselines. His best Games Finished season came in 1993, posting 24, well above the relief pitcher average of 15.5 that year. The lowest point came in 1990 at 1, well below the relief pitcher average of 14.8 that year. Production slipped through the final seasons. The Games Finished total went from 24 in 1993 to 5 in 1995 and 6 in 1996, falling over the span. The decline marked the closing chapter of the career. Significant season-to-season variance characterizes the Games Finished profile — ranging from 1 to 24 — though the career average remained well below league norms.
